About Jean-Paul C. Montagnier

  • Jean-Paul C.
  • Montagnier (born September 28, 1965 at Lyon) is a French musicologist.
  • He studied at the Conservatoire National SupĂ©rieur de Musique de Paris, where he received two first prizes in musical analysis (1988, professor: Claude Ballif) and music history (1989, professor: Yves GĂ©rard), before completing a PhD at Duke University (1994).
  • He is currently Professor of musicology at the University of Lorraine (Nancy, France), and Associate Member of the Institut de Recherche en Musicologie (CNRS).
  • He also was Adjunct Professor at McGill University.
  • He was involved with Musica Gallica, an edition of the works of the musical patrimony of France.
  • He serves on the editorial board of the Collected Works of Jean-Baptiste Lully published by Olms (Germany).
  • He was made Officer in the Order of Arts and Letters by the French Government in 2012.
  • He was nominated to become a Robert M.
  • Trotter Visiting Distinguished Professor at the University of Oregon School of Music and Dance during the 2018–2019 academic year.
  • He specializes in the sacred music of the French Baroque, and has extensively published in numerous international journals.
  • In addition to several books and book chapters, he has also edited many scores and facsimiles.
  • He is regularly invited to lecture and teach in North-American and European universities. He is a member of several learned societies, among which the American Musicological Society, the Royal Musical Association, and the International Musicological Society. His grandfather, Georges Montagnier (1892-1967), was a novelist, playwrighter and poet.
